A Boy Named Sue is a 2001 documentary film directed by Julie Wyman. It shows the life and transition of Theo, a transgender man who undergoes various stages of transition (including a mastectomy and hormone therapy). The protagonist is filmed extensively throughout, gives a number of interviews, and eventually settles down as a gay male. The film's title is taken from the song A Boy Named Sue .

Distribution and reception

The film played at several festivals including the 2000 San Francisco International Lesbian and Gay Film Festival and Reel Affirmations. [1] [2] It was nominated for a 2004 GLAAD Media Award. [3]
